New ADMA Feature: Multidestination

ADMA now offers an enhanced data transmission option: data can also be sent via direct IP to up to five specific target IP addresses simultaneously.

How do users benefit?

Previously, the ADMAnet data stream was transmitted via Direct-IP or broadcast, resulting in relatively high network utilization when sending data to multiple devices. With the latest update, data can now be sent via Direct-IP to up to five specific target IP addresses simultaneously, significantly reducing network load.
